Properly stored, cooked white rice will last for 4 to 6 days in the refrigerator. How long can cooked white rice be left out at room temperature? Cooked white rice should be discarded if left out for more than 2 hours at room temperature, as bacteria grow rapidly at temperatures between 40 °F and 140 °F.

WebJan 7, 2016 · Improperly stored brown rice that is exposed to high amounts of moisture may start to grow mold. Keeping the rice in a tightly sealed container, and in a cold environment should prevent this, but rice that has any signs of mold growth should be discarded. Cooked rice that has gone bad will start to harden as it loses moisture, and can grow mold ...
